The Industrial Engineer - Senior plans and oversees layout of equipment, office and production facilities. Responsibilities include but not limited to:

  • Conducts studies in operations to maximize work flow and spatial utilization.

  • Ensures facility efficiency and workplace safety.

  • Perform cycle time and bottleneck analyses.

  • Develop and improve work methods.

  • Work with functional managers and operation managers to improve productivity, quality, and throughput. Support World Class Manufacturing (WCM) especially for WO (Workplace Organization) and LO (Logistic) pillars.

  • Support IE Manager in various IE and WCM related assignments and projects.

  • Perform manpower planning/leveling/adjustments per Assembly Plants' Volume Adjustments.

  • Perform Direct Labor, Indirect Labor, and Ergonomic Studies.

  • Interact with production management and union leadership on a daily basis on all matters relating to staffing requirements and IE activities.
